Based on the provided information, this device is not an IVD (In Vitro Diagnostic).
Here's why:
- IVD Definition: In Vitro Diagnostics are devices intended for use in the collection, preparation, and examination of specimens taken from the human body (such as blood, urine, or tissue) to provide information for the diagnosis, treatment, or prevention of disease.
- Device Function: This device analyzes physiological signals (ECG and oximetry data) collected from the patient's body in vivo (while the patient is alive and the data is being recorded from within or on the body). It does not analyze specimens taken from the body.
- Intended Use: The intended use is to screen for sleep apnea based on physiological data, not to analyze biological samples.
Therefore, while it is a medical device used for diagnosis-related purposes, it falls outside the definition of an In Vitro Diagnostic.

§ 868.2375 Breathing frequency monitor.
(a)
Identification. A breathing (ventilatory) frequency monitor is a device intended to measure or monitor a patient's respiratory rate. The device may provide an audible or visible alarm when the respiratory rate, averaged over time, is outside operator settable alarm limits. This device does not include the apnea monitor classified in § 868.2377.(b)
Classification. Class II (performance standards).

The DR-180+ Oxy Holter is a Holter Monitor that can also detect oxygen saturation in blood (SpO2). The DR-180+ Oxy Holter is utilized with the Holter LX Analysis software subject to this submission.
K081861 Page 2023
The subject device (Holter LX Analysis software) utilizes the exact algorithm as the predicate device (LifeScreen Apnea). The algorithm is provided to both manufacturers by Biancamed.
The main differences are as follows:
- The Holter LX Analysis can also utilize oxygen saturation in blood (SPO2) when used with ◆ the DR180+ Oxy Holter.
- . The underlying algorithm remains the same, but the AHI is calculated using oximetry data from a study conducted by Biancamed.
- The Holter LX Analysis is used with North East Monitoring Holter Monitors. ●
Comparison of test data between the Holter LX Analysis software and the LifeScreeen Apnea device found equivalent results for sensitivity, specificity, accuracy, and positive predictivity. We believe the subject device is substantially equivalent to the predicate device.

Description of the Device [21 CFR 807.92(a)(4)]
Holter LX Analysis is a software option to the Holter for Windows software (K930564).
The software has been designed to detect sleep disordered breathing due to obstructive apneas or hyponneas. The software uses 2 channel ECG and oximetry data collected via the DR180+ Holter Recorder to calculate the patient's Apnea-Hypopnea Index (AHI). The Holter and Oxymetry ECG data obtained by monitoring is not analyzed at the time of recording is complete, the data must be downloaded to a compatible NorthEast Monitoring Holter LX Analysis with sleep apnea software system to be analyzed by a healthcare professional.
The sleep apnea monitoring algorithm used in the subject device is the exact algorithm already cleared by FDA.
The Sleep Technician or Physician will utilize standard Holter procedure to hook up the recorder to the patient. The patient will sleep with the recorder for one night in order to collect data. Either the patient or a sleep clinician will note the time that the patient falls asleep and awakens. The sampling rate is 180 samples/second.
The Holter LX Analysis software detects each R-wave. The calculations of AHI are performed. The Holter LX Analysis software can only be used in conjunction with North East Monitoring Holter recorders.
The Holter software was originally cleared by FDA under K930564. The software subject to this 510(k) adds the sleep apnea monitoring capabilities.
The North East Monitoring DR180+ Oxy was cleared under K004007. There are no hardware as a result of this addition.
Intended Use [21 CFR 807.92(a)(5)]
Indications For Use: Intended for use on adult patients only as a screening device to determine the need for clinical diagnosis and evaluation by polysomnography based on the patient's score. The ECG recording may be obtained at any location specified by a physician including home, hospital, or clinic. Subjects screened for sleep apnea should have periods of sleep of at least 4 hours during which the ECG is predominantly sinus rhythm in nature.
